Output 58b7a5c043a947182073ebf6f2c2e00ab9896eeb266a9410dfba10f966464f84:1

value
9306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0546841c9f3742755abe98a2868e8b2a5073739 OP_EQUAL
address
3KDxn6QVj52e38eaugQQJjzLvuPjDfxywb
transaction
58b7a5c043a947182073ebf6f2c2e00ab9896eeb266a9410dfba10f966464f84
spent
true